The FS32K148HET0MLQT is a state-of-the-art microcontroller unit (MCU) offered by NXP Semiconductors, a leading provider in the field of automotive and industrial electronics. This product is part of the S32K1xx MCU family, designed specifically for general purpose automotive and high-reliability industrial applications.
Key Features
- Core: The MCU features an ARM Cortex-M4F core that operates at a frequency of up to 80 MHz, providing a balanced combination of computing power and energy efficiency, making it suitable for a wide range of applications.
- Memory: It comes with 512 KB of flash memory and 64 KB of RAM, ensuring sufficient space for complex applications and data handling.
- Package: The device is available in a 64-pin LQFP package, which is ideal for space-constrained applications while still offering ample I/O options.
- Temperature Range: With an extended temperature range from -40°C to +125°C, this MCU is built to perform reliably in harsh environmental conditions.
- Analog Features: It includes multiple analog features such as 2x 16-bit analog-to-digital converters (ADCs) with 32 channels, 2x 12-bit digital-to-analog converters (DACs), and multiple analog comparators, providing excellent interfacing capabilities for sensor-based applications.
- Connectivity: The FS32K148HET0MLQT supports a range of communication interfaces, including CAN FD, LIN, SPI, I2C, and UART, allowing for versatile connectivity options in complex automotive and industrial systems.
- Safety and Reliability: The MCU is designed with a focus on safety, incorporating features that enable it to meet the ISO 26262 standard for automotive safety integrity level (ASIL). It also includes a hardware security module (HSM) for secure data handling and protection against unauthorized access.
Applications
This microcontroller is ideally suited for a variety of applications within the automotive sector, including body electronics, sensor fusion, motor control systems, and advanced driver assistance systems (ADAS). It is also well-suited for industrial applications that require robust performance and high reliability, such as factory automation, robotics, and process control.
